PROBLEM TO BE SOLVED: To eliminate the leakage of each air path and to prevent seizing due to the mixture of a foreign object in actual use on assembly by using a seal material, in a structure that cannot be sealed by neither a material with a self-lubrication property between air paths nor a member that is subjected to self-lubrication covering and undergoes relative movement. SOLUTION: The outer shape of seal rings 31a-31c is nearly identical to the inner diameter of a housing 15, the inner diameter is smaller than the outer shape of a rod 16 and is larger than the diameter of the part of a seal ring- positioning groove 34, and furthermore the thickness of the seal ring is smaller than the width of the seal ring-positioning mechanism 34. A nozzle is made of a material with self-lubrication property or a material that is subjected to self-lubrication covering, and for example a PTFE resin or a material obtained by coating a sintered metal or the like with resin or a material that is subjected to compound plating can be used, thus improving the airtightness of the air path of the nozzle and the suction force of the nozzle and hence speedily packaging parts. |
